REVIEW

Sean McGinnis (Cunio) has been renting the classics and by error gets Citizen Cum instead of Citizen Kane. So starts a tale of sexual obsession that changes the course of Sean's life and brings great drama to the screen. The star of Citizen Cum is Johnny Rebel (Gurney) a hot "gay for pay" porn star with drug, relationship and stability problems. Sean becomes so smitten with Johnny that he applies for work at "Men of Janus" - the studio that produces the source of Sean's bliss. Sean gets a job on the set of Johnny's next film and goes beyond camera work to perform a job that most gay men would pay to do. He becomes a fluffer who performs oral sex so that the porn performer is hard on camera. After servicing him, Sean becomes even more enamored with Johnny whose life is spiraling out of control. Johnny's girlfriend Babylon locks him out of the house and his drug use is growing exponentially. There is some nasty violence and the two guys go on a journey that will change the course of their lives. This non-sexually explicit, but very sexy, tale takes Sean and Johnny to places where only the truly obsessed would dare go!

Wash West's first non-adult film is a well-told tale of obsession that manages to illustrate the allure of the porn business while telling a fairly difficult tale of obsession.

Scott Cranin

"The Max Ophuls masterpiece Letter From an Unknown Woman suggests in its very title the self-abnegation of the fluffer. Midnight Cowboy documents Ratso Rizzo's selfless idolatry of Joe Buck, which remains unconsummated, as all fluffer love affairs must. Yet it was Rebel Without a Cause which, in its triangular relationship among a girl, a gay man, and a beautiful boy who swings both ways, gave us the template for the central triangle of the movie. In all three of these movies, the classic fluffer figure dies. Clearly there was room for an update."
Richard Glatzer and Wash West
